Abstract

This invention discloses an exhaust pipe installation method and a diesel generator device thereof, comprising: a generator component including a diesel generator and an air supply pipe connected to the diesel generator; and an installation component including an output component located at the air supply pipe and a guide component located inside the output component. This invention allows the guide component to move by placing the exhaust pipe on the air supply pipe and pressing it. Simultaneously, the guide component moves and actuates the actuating component. When the actuating component is actuated, it causes a clamping component to clamp at the connection between the exhaust pipe and the output pipe. The installation is then completed using a locking component, thus facilitating the installation of the exhaust pipe.

[0061] Reference Figures 1-8 This embodiment differs from the above embodiments in that it also includes a main body component 100 located at the bottom of the diesel generator 501, a buffer component 200 connected to the main body component 100, a storage component 300 located on the main body component 100, and a storage component 400 connected to the storage component 300.

[0062] The main component 100 includes a limiting component 101 connected to the diesel generator 501 and a bearing component 102 connected to the limiting component 101; the buffer component 200 includes a connecting component 201 connected to the diesel generator 501 and a conversion component 202 disposed within the connecting component 201. The bearing component 102 is connected to the diesel generator and firstly supports the diesel generator 501 through the limiting component 101. During the operation of the diesel generator 501, vibrations are generated. By limiting the vibrations through the bearing component 102, the diesel generator 501 can only vibrate vertically. Simultaneously, the vertical vibrations of the diesel generator 501 drive the connecting component 201 to move vertically. During this movement, the conversion component 202 converts the vertical movement force into a rotational force. Furthermore, the limiting component 101 contains resistance that restricts the conversion component 202, thereby dissipating the vertical movement force and achieving a vibration reduction effect.

[0063] The limiting assembly 101 includes a telescopic rod 101a connected to the diesel generator 501, a base 101b connected to the telescopic rod 101a, and a damping cavity 101c opened in the base 101b; wherein, the sleeve portion of the telescopic rod 101a is disposed in the output slot 201c. The bearing assembly 102 includes a support rod 102a disposed on the top of the base 101b, a sliding groove 102b opened on the surface of the support rod 102a, and a connecting block 102c disposed in the sliding groove 102b; wherein, the connecting block 102c is connected to the diesel generator 501, the telescopic rod 101a is fixedly connected to the middle of the bottom end of the diesel generator 501, the bottom end of the telescopic rod 101a is fixedly connected to the base 101b, the damping cavity 101c is opened inside the base 101b, the damping cavity 101c is filled with water, and the sleeve portion of the telescopic rod 101a is disposed in the damping cavity 101a. Inside c, support rods 102a are fixedly connected to both sides of the top of the base 101b. Slide grooves 102b are opened on the side of the support rods 102a that are close to each other. Connecting blocks 102c are slidably connected inside the slide grooves 102b on both sides. The ends of the connecting blocks 102c that are close to each other are fixedly connected to the two sides of the diesel generator 501. The vibration generated by the diesel generator 501 during use is restricted by the connecting blocks 102c on both sides, so that it can only vibrate up and down. Thus, while the telescopic rods 101a support the diesel generator 501, they can also make it vibrate up and down. When it vibrates up and down, it will also drive the connecting component 201 to move. Then, the conversion component 202 rotates in the damping cavity 101c. The water in the damping cavity 101c increases the resistance to rotation, thereby dissipating the force of movement and achieving the effect of vibration reduction.

[0064] The connecting assembly 201 includes an output rod 201a disposed under the diesel generator 501, an adapter groove 201b formed within the output rod 201a, and an output groove 201c formed on the outer surface of the adapter groove 201b; wherein the output rod 201a is slidably connected to the base 101b, and the output groove 201c communicates with the adapter groove 201b. The conversion assembly 202 includes a conversion rod 202a disposed within the adapter groove 201b, a spiral groove 202b formed on the outer surface of the conversion rod 202a, a toggle rod 202c disposed within the spiral groove 202b, and a drag-increasing blade 202d disposed at the end of the conversion rod 202a; wherein the end of the conversion rod 202a passes through the output rod 201a, the toggle rod 202c is connected to the base 101b, and the output rod 201a is fixedly connected to both sides of the bottom end of the diesel generator 501. a. The output rod 201a is slidably connected to the base 101b and can extend into the damping cavity 101c. The output rod 201a has an adapter groove 201b inside and an output groove 201c on one side of the adapter groove 201b. A conversion rod 202a is rotatably connected inside the adapter groove 201b. One end of the conversion rod 202a passes through the adapter groove 201b and extends to the outside. Multiple drag-increasing blades 202d are fixedly connected to the outside of the rod body of the conversion rod 202a outside the adapter groove 201b. A spiral groove 202b is opened on the outer surface of the rod body of the conversion rod 202a. A toggle rod 202c is slidably connected inside the spiral groove 202b. The toggle rod 202c is fixedly connected at the connection between the base 101b and the output rod 201a, and the toggle rod 202c is set in the output groove 201c and matches it.

[0065] When the diesel generator 501 vibrates and moves up and down, it drives the output rod 201a and the conversion rod 202a to move up and down. Then, by using the actuating rod 202c to move the spiral groove 202b on the outside of the conversion rod 202a, the conversion rod 202a can rotate along the trajectory of the spiral groove 202b. This then drives the drag-increasing blade 202d outside the adapter groove 201b to rotate in both directions. In addition, the water in the damping cavity 101c just submerges the position of the drag-increasing blade 202d. When the drag-increasing blade 202d rotates, the water inside it will increase its rotational resistance, thus reducing the rotation amplitude of the conversion rod 202a. At the same time, the movement amplitude of the output rod 201a and the conversion rod 202a will also decrease. When the movement amplitude of the output rod 201a and the conversion rod 202a decreases, the up-and-down vibration amplitude of the diesel generator 501 will also decrease, thereby achieving the purpose of damping the vibration of the diesel generator 501.

[0066] It also includes a storage component 300, which includes a collection component 301 connected to the limiting component 101 and a conversion component 302 connected to the collection component 301. During the long-term operation of the diesel generator, the ambient temperature will rise, and the water in the damping chamber 101c will evaporate. The evaporated water vapor will make the surrounding environment humid, which will affect the use of the diesel generator 501 in the long run. At this time, the collection component 301 can be used to collect the water vapor to prevent it from making the surrounding environment humid. The collected water vapor is then input into the conversion component 202, and the water vapor is converted back into water and injected into the water storage device.

[0067] The collection assembly 301 includes a collection cover 301a located at the connection between the output rod 201a and the base 101b, and a collection pipe 301b connected to the collection cover 301a. The conversion assembly 302 includes a conversion hopper 302a connected to the collection pipe 301b, a fan 302b located above the conversion hopper 302a, and a guide pipe 302c located below the conversion hopper 302a. The collection cover 301a is fixedly connected to the connection between the base 101b and the output rod 201a. The collection pipe 301b is fixedly connected to one side of the collection cover 301a. The collection pipe 301b passes through the lower side of the support rod 102a and is fixedly connected to the conversion hopper 302a. A cooling device is installed inside the conversion hopper 302a. The conversion hopper 302a is fixedly connected to the top of the support rod 102a, and a guide pipe is provided at the bottom of the conversion hopper. 302c, A fan 302b is installed at the top of the conversion hopper 302a. By starting the fan 302b, the water vapor volatilized inside the shock-absorbing chamber 101c is extracted from the output slot 201c at its connection and introduced into the conversion hopper 302a through the collection pipe 301b. Then, the cooling device inside the conversion hopper 302a makes the temperature inside the conversion hopper 302a lower than the outside temperature. At the same time, when the water vapor enters the conversion hopper 302a, it will condense into dew and then flow into the water storage device along the guide pipe 302c. In addition, the conversion hopper 302a is designed as a trapezoidal cylinder, and its side can easily allow the converted water to flow into the guide pipe 302c. The guide pipe 302c is set so that the section connected to the conversion hopper 302a is vertical, the middle section is inclined, and the outlet section is vertical to prevent the converted water from accumulating in the water pipe.

[0068] It also includes a storage component 400, which includes a receiving component 401 connected to the conversion component 302 and a control component 402 located in the limiting component 101. The receiving component 401 stores the water converted in the conversion component 302, and the control component 402 detects the water level in the damping cavity 101c. When the water level in the damping cavity 101c cannot submerge the drag-increasing blade 202d, it can trigger the injection of water from the receiving component 401 into the damping cavity 101c until the water level inside submerges the drag-increasing blade 202d, thereby preventing the water level from failing to submerge the drag-increasing blade 202d and reducing the damping effect on the diesel generator.

[0069] The housing assembly 401 includes a concave water tank 401a connected to a guide pipe 302c, a connecting pipe 401b connected to the concave water tank 401a, and a blocking rod 401c disposed within the damping cavity 101c. The connecting pipe 401b is connected to the base 101b and communicates with the damping cavity 101c. The blocking rod 401c matches the connecting pipe 401b. The outlet of the guide pipe 302c is fixedly connected to the top of the concave water tank 401a and communicates with its interior. The protruding part of the concave water tank 401a is fixedly connected to the outside of the support rod 102a. The bottom end of the concave water tank 401a is fixedly connected to the connecting pipe 401b. The outlet of the connecting pipe 401b is connected to the base 101b and extends into the damping cavity 101c. Furthermore, the blocking rod 401c... Rod 401c is positioned below the connection point between the shock-absorbing cavity 101c and the connecting pipe 401b, and is slidably connected to the inner wall of the shock-absorbing cavity 101c. Rod 401c can block its outlet. In the initial state, rod 401c blocks the connecting pipe 401b to prevent water in the concave water tank 401a from entering the shock-absorbing cavity 101c. When the water level drops, rod 401c moves away from the connecting pipe 401b, and water in the concave water tank 401a will be injected into the shock-absorbing cavity 101c through the outlet of the connecting pipe 401b. When the water level reaches a certain level, control component 402 will control rod 401c to block the outlet of the connecting pipe 401b to prevent water injection, thereby achieving the purpose of controlling the water level inside the shock-absorbing cavity 101c.

[0070] The control assembly 402 includes a swing rod 402a connected to a blocking rod 401c, a fixed rod 402b located at one end of the swing rod 402a, and a float 402c located at the other end of the swing rod 402a. The fixed rod 402b is connected to the inner wall of the damping cavity 101c. The swing rod 402a is rotatably connected to one side of the blocking rod 401c via a shaft. The fixed rod 402b is rotatably connected to one end of the swing rod 402a located on the side of the blocking rod 401c. The top end of the fixed rod 402b is fixedly connected to the top end of the inner wall of the damping cavity 101c. The float 402c is rotatably connected to the side of the swing rod 402a away from the fixed rod 402b. When the water level drops, the float 402c follows the water level, which in turn drives the swing rod 402a to rotate around the bottom of the fixed rod 402b. This causes the blocking rod 401c to descend and move away from the inlet. At this time, the water in the concave water tank 401a enters the damping chamber 101c through the connecting pipe 401b, causing the water level inside to rise. The float 402c also rises with the water level, and the end of the swing rod 402a located on the float 402c also rises, which in turn drives the blocking rod 401c in the middle to rise until the blocking rod 401c blocks the inlet and stops. This achieves the purpose of keeping the interior able to submerge the drag-increasing blade 202d.
